So, my low coolant light has been blinking on and off. The car isn't running hot, the coolant levels aren't low at all, nothing is leaking. Dad suggested it might be he thermostat, but I think it might be the low coolant sensor. Googling on the Buick forums has shown this is a typical issue, especially on older Regals.

I'm just trying to decide if this is a repair I should attempt to do myself, or if I should pay the mechanic to do it when I take the car in for an inspection check on Friday. I think the car needs new front brake pads, too, I'm pretty sure I heard the warning strip squealing the other day.
